About Yuanyuan Wu
Yuanyuan Wu is a scholar working on Inorganic Chemistry, Microbiology and Catalysis, having authored 66 papers that have together received 709 indexed citations. Recurring topics across this work include Advanced Neuroimaging Techniques and Applications (6 papers), Metal complexes synthesis and properties (5 papers) and Cervical and Thoracic Myelopathy (5 papers). The work is most often cited by research in Ecology, Evolution, Behavior and Systematics (107 citations), Organic Chemistry (128 citations) and Obstetrics and Gynecology (35 citations). Yuanyuan Wu has collaborated with scholars based in China, United States and Germany. Frequent co-authors include Na Hou, Song Yang, Peiyi Wang, Liwei Liu, Zhong Li, Hai‐Shun Wu, Jianjun Zhu, Zhou‐Qing Long, Wu‐Bin Shao and Faek Menla Ali. Their work appears in journals such as Nature Communications, SHILAP Revista de lepidopterología and Physical Review B.
